
What is LED- UV Printing

LED UV printing is a modern technology used in printing that utilizes Ultraviolet light to dry or cure specially formulated ink as it is printed. Furthermore, UV-LED printing is characterized by its environmentally friendly nature, with minimal emissions and low energy consumption. This allows for a quicker and more efficient printing process. UV printing can be used on 90% of solid materials, including wood, plastic, metal, ceramic and many more. artisJet UV printers can even achieve a distinct 3D raised printing effect, enabling the printing of ADA standard braille. UV printers are commonly used for printing on promotional items, packaging, and other commercial applications. However the possibilities are endless, these printers truly are a “business in a box!”
